Composting
North Hill composts over 700 lbs of food per week.
Lighting
All light bulbs on campus are now transitioned to LED lighting.
EV Chargers
North Hill has 2 EV charging stations with 2 plugins on each. Two more with 2 plugins each are on their way.
Recycling
North Hill has a comprehensive recycling program for residents and all departments throughout the campus.
Dechlorinator
North Hill Installed a dechlorinator in the pool that neutralizes 100 lbs of chlorine from the water per year helping to protect wildlife in local streams and rivers
Plastic
With new water bottle refill stations across campus we’ve saved 86,000 water bottles so far.
Laundry
North Hill has switched to using ozone in our laundry systems, saving 456 gallons of water per day.
Paper Towels
Our campus-wide paper towel dispensers have saved an estimated 882,000 sheets per year.
